Abstract

The influence of Ca in place of Sr and Eu in place of La on the superconducting and normal state behaviour of La1.8Sr0.2CuO4 has been investigated. Both the substituents tend to depress the superconducting transition temperature, whereas the degree of semiconducting (localization)-like behaviour in resistance for the air-annealed specimens in the normal state are widely different. The data are discussed in terms of possible size and charge mismatch effects.
